A-20H 44-002 crash east of Tucson AZ on August 9, 1945

Copyright © Chris McDoniel

Two Wright Field Service pilots died in the crash of A-20H on August 9, 1945. The crashed occurred during a rain storm on the south side of the Rincon Mountains. First Lieutenant Russell L. Mathern and Captain Holbrook Snyder were fatally injured.

Interesting debris from the A-20H. In the upper right portion of the piece is a US Navy inspection stamp. You can berely see the "US" between an anchor. The faint remains of an "R" is probably a Douglas inspection stamp.
